Routine examinations should begin as early as age two, and continue every six months. These visits enable your Lone Tree pediatric dentist to monitor smiles as they grow, and if areas of concern develop, such as toothaches, or gingivitis, then treatment might be required. In addition, kids can often receive fluoride treatments to strengthen the outer enamel of their teeth and prevent tooth caries. Dental sealants, which coat the occlusal surfaces of the posterior teeth, can protect teeth for years to come. In fact, sealants can provide protection against tooth cavities for as long as ten years in some cases.

The third molars are in the back of the mouth, and there is one on each quadrant. They most commonly appear between seventeen and twenty-five. Because they come in later than the rest of your teeth, their appearance can cause complications with your existing ones. They can erupt at unusual directions, only partially come in, or overcrowd your existing teeth. When this occurs, they are more susceptible to harmful bacteria. If any of these situations happen, it can be very uncomfortable and can affect your existing teeth. If you think you might have issues with wisdom teeth coming in, it is important to see a Lone Tree dentist as soon as possible.


If you do need wisdom tooth removal, your oral healthcare professional will determine how they will go about the removal to make sure everything goes without complications. They will decide which of your wisdom teeth need to be removed and how complex it will be. They will also determine the appropriate type of anesthesia and the state of your existing teeth. Once they ascertain this information, they can plan your wisdom teeth extraction more easily. When you come in for the procedure, you will receive the appropriate sedation option, so you will not feel any pain. Your dentist will extract your teeth and monitor you the entire time to make sure you are ok. Once your wisdom teeth are removed, you will be provided with information about the recovery period. In addition to offering biannual dental checkups and cleanings, pediatric dentists on Doctors Network also provide your little children with protective sealants. These are small pieces of BPA-free acrylic that dentists paint onto their molars. They work as a protective film that forms a barrier between their molars and germs. This ultimately prevents the risk of cavities by up to 80 percent. It is a simple tool that is very effective at preventing cavities in the future.


Fluoride treatments are another proven tool that your dentists provide. Fluoride is a natural mineral that helps fortify your child’s teeth. While enamel is one of the strongest substances our bodies produce, it can still weaken over time. When this occurs, your kid’s teeth become more susceptible to cavities. Fluoride treatment helps stop decay from occurring. Using toothpaste that has fluoride can also help. When you visit your Lone Tree dental care provider, they can provide you with either an in-office or even at-home treatment option. With the in-office option, you will typically be out within about an hour, and you will have noticeably whiter teeth. For this option, your dentist will apply a gel solution to your teeth that they will then activate with a special light, to remove stains.

If you would prefer to choose whitening from the comfort of your home, your dentist will give you a set of custom trays that you can fill up with a safe peroxide solution. You will wear these for a few hours each day for approximately two weeks. Once this treatment is done, you will have a brighter smile. When you visit your dentist for a checkup, they will start with a thorough cleaning. This will remove plaque and tartar that is tough to remove at home — even with fantastic brushing and flossing habits. The dental prophylaxis will leave your teeth feeling rejuvenated.

Once your cleaning is over, your Lone Tree dentist will begin his examination. During this portion of your appointment, the dentist will thoroughly look at your mouth to identify any potential problems. Should they notice something awry, they can suggest the proper treatment.
